Home
last modified time | relevance | path

Searched refs:vxrxq_lock (Results 1 – 2 of 2) sorted by relevance

/dragonfly/sys/dev/virtual/vmware/vmxnet3/
H A Dif_vmxvar.h167 struct lock vxrxq_lock; member
181 #define VMXNET3_RXQ_LOCK(_rxq) lockmgr(&(_rxq)->vxrxq_lock, LK_EXCLUSIVE)
182 #define VMXNET3_RXQ_UNLOCK(_rxq) lockmgr(&(_rxq)->vxrxq_lock, LK_RELEASE)
184 KKASSERT(lockowned(&(_rxq)->vxrxq_lock) != 0)
186 KKASSERT(lockowned(&(_rxq)->vxrxq_lock) == 0)
H A Dif_vmx.c1038 lockinit(&rxq->vxrxq_lock, rxq->vxrxq_name, 0, 0); in vmxnet3_init_rxq()
1152 if (mtx_initialized(&rxq->vxrxq_lock) != 0) in vmxnet3_destroy_rxq()
1154 lockuninit(&rxq->vxrxq_lock); in vmxnet3_destroy_rxq()